
Efficient Code Search with Zoekt (eBook, ePUB)
The Complete Guide for Developers and Engineers
PAYBACK Punkte
0 °P sammeln!
"Efficient Code Search with Zoekt" "Efficient Code Search with Zoekt" offers a comprehensive, in-depth exploration of modern code search principles, with a particular focus on Zoekt, one of the most powerful open-source search engines for source code. Beginning with the foundational role of code search in large-scale software engineering, the book presents essential concepts in information retrieval and evaluates the critical challenges inherent to searching vast, heterogeneous codebases. Readers gain clarity on what constitutes an effective code search system, not only through a comparison of...
"Efficient Code Search with Zoekt"
"Efficient Code Search with Zoekt" offers a comprehensive, in-depth exploration of modern code search principles, with a particular focus on Zoekt, one of the most powerful open-source search engines for source code. Beginning with the foundational role of code search in large-scale software engineering, the book presents essential concepts in information retrieval and evaluates the critical challenges inherent to searching vast, heterogeneous codebases. Readers gain clarity on what constitutes an effective code search system, not only through a comparison of tools but by understanding the unique advantages open-source solutions like Zoekt bring to collaborative development environments.
The core architectural details of Zoekt are meticulously unpacked, covering its indexing pipeline, handling of concurrency and parallelism, and robust query processing capabilities. Practical techniques for efficient indexing, scaling, and integrating Zoekt into enterprise infrastructure are addressed in depth, including strategies for horizontal scaling, distributed deployment, and the management of massive repositories and monorepos. From CI/CD integration to advanced search capabilities-such as regex, structural, and cross-repository search-the book serves as both a technical manual and a practical guide, suitable for developers, DevOps engineers, and technical leaders seeking to extract maximum value from their codebases.
Security, performance optimization, and compliance receive thorough treatment, with pragmatic advice on monitoring, tuning, and safeguarding code search environments within even the most stringent regulatory contexts. The book concludes by looking ahead: exploring semantic and AI-assisted innovations, the evolution of community contributions, and the open challenges shaping the next generation of code search technologies. "Efficient Code Search with Zoekt" is an essential resource for any organization or individual seeking to master or implement high-performance code search in complex, evolving ecosystems.
"Efficient Code Search with Zoekt" offers a comprehensive, in-depth exploration of modern code search principles, with a particular focus on Zoekt, one of the most powerful open-source search engines for source code. Beginning with the foundational role of code search in large-scale software engineering, the book presents essential concepts in information retrieval and evaluates the critical challenges inherent to searching vast, heterogeneous codebases. Readers gain clarity on what constitutes an effective code search system, not only through a comparison of tools but by understanding the unique advantages open-source solutions like Zoekt bring to collaborative development environments.
The core architectural details of Zoekt are meticulously unpacked, covering its indexing pipeline, handling of concurrency and parallelism, and robust query processing capabilities. Practical techniques for efficient indexing, scaling, and integrating Zoekt into enterprise infrastructure are addressed in depth, including strategies for horizontal scaling, distributed deployment, and the management of massive repositories and monorepos. From CI/CD integration to advanced search capabilities-such as regex, structural, and cross-repository search-the book serves as both a technical manual and a practical guide, suitable for developers, DevOps engineers, and technical leaders seeking to extract maximum value from their codebases.
Security, performance optimization, and compliance receive thorough treatment, with pragmatic advice on monitoring, tuning, and safeguarding code search environments within even the most stringent regulatory contexts. The book concludes by looking ahead: exploring semantic and AI-assisted innovations, the evolution of community contributions, and the open challenges shaping the next generation of code search technologies. "Efficient Code Search with Zoekt" is an essential resource for any organization or individual seeking to master or implement high-performance code search in complex, evolving ecosystems.
Dieser Download kann aus rechtlichen Gründen nur mit Rechnungsadresse in A, B, BG, CY, CZ, D, DK, EW, E, FIN, F, GR, H, IRL, I, LT, L, LR, M, NL, PL, P, R, S, SLO, SK ausgeliefert werden.